Transaction e56c0bfaa03bee46ea4b52cd67a6a125409bbf43b176d37c1d1a2dfd2a3995e5

block
4292a3c8d26260e0d93c1bda0b43a88189b4269488470836dc1cf18aedac386b

1 Input

24 Outputs